Neuroimaging Research points to Objective Concussion Detection Methods

Detecting concussion is typically not possible with current clinically used brain imaging, such as MRI and CT scans. However, research coming out of Canada suggests that magnetoencephalographic (MEG) imaging is able to measure brain activity mapping how various areas of the brain interact which can then be analysed to diagnose a concussion.
